    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ik offers undergraduate and postgraduate level and doctoral programmes that are available full-time.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ik courses are available in the Medicine and Allied Sciences and Science streams.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ik course is BAMS at the undergraduate level. 

    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ik PG courses are MS and MD.  The PhD course is offered for 6 years at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ik.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ik UG Course duration is 5.5 years.

    Ayurved Mahavidyalaya, Nashik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's)

    1: What is the eligibility criteria of BAMS Course at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ik?

    To be eligible for BAMS Course at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ik, candidates must pass class 12th in science stream with at least 50% marks in aggregate.

    2: What is the fee structure of BAMS Course at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ik?

    The fee structure of BAMS Course at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ik is Rs 2,50,000.

    3: Is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ik Courses approved?

    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ik Courses are approved by the Central Council of Indian Medicine.

    4: What are the specialised courses in MS at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ik?

    Shalyatantra is the specialised course in MS at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ik.

    5: How many years are required for BAMS at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ik?

    The BAMS  course at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ik is 5 years and 6 months.

    6: Can we study BAMS without NEET at Ayurved Mahavidyalaya Nashik?

    No, it is not possible to study BAMS without NEET as per the Ministry of Ayush CCIM rules
